Many states and cities have already implemented school uniform regulations in their schools. In cities such as Baltimore, Cincinnati, Dayton, Detroit, Los Angeles, Miami, Memphis, Milwaukee, Nashville, New Orleans, Phoenix, Seattle and St. Louis, mandatory uniform restrictions have been put into practice. With such large cities already using these restrictions for their students, obviously somebody else feels the same way I do.
